Kaedah penyulitan storan data termasuk penyulitan simetri, penyulitan asimetri dan algoritma cincang. Pengenalan terperinci: 1. Penyulitan simetri, algoritma penyulitan simetri yang biasa digunakan termasuk DES, AES dan Twofish 2. Penyulitan asimetri, algoritma penyulitan asimetri yang biasa digunakan termasuk RSA, ECC dan DSA 3. Algoritma hash, algoritma hash yang biasa digunakan termasuk SHA -1, SHA-256, MD5, dsb.
Kaedah penyulitan storan data terutamanya termasuk penyulitan simetri, penyulitan asimetri dan algoritma cincang.
1. Penyulitan simetri: Penyulitan simetri bermakna kunci yang sama digunakan untuk penyulitan dan penyahsulitan. Dalam penyulitan storan data, algoritma penyulitan simetri yang biasa digunakan termasuk DES, AES, Twofish, dsb. Keselamatan algoritma ini bergantung pada kerahsiaan kunci, jadi pengurusan kunci adalah sangat penting.
2. Penyulitan asimetri: Penyulitan asimetrik bermaksud penyulitan dan penyahsulitan menggunakan kunci yang berbeza, iaitu kunci awam dan kunci persendirian. Dalam penyulitan storan data, algoritma penyulitan asimetri yang biasa digunakan termasuk RSA, ECC dan DSA. Keselamatan algoritma ini bergantung pada kesukaran masalah matematik, seperti masalah penguraian integer besar, masalah logaritma diskret, dsb.
3 Algoritma cincang: Algoritma cincang memetakan data input dari sebarang panjang ke dalam data output dengan panjang tetap, dan biasanya digunakan untuk pengesahan integriti data. Dalam penyulitan storan data, algoritma cincang yang biasa digunakan termasuk SHA-1, SHA-256, MD5, dsb. Ciri-ciri algoritma ini ialah data keluaran adalah tetap dan unik serta boleh dikira dengan cepat, tetapi sukar untuk mencari pemetaan terbalik.
Ringkasnya, kaedah penyulitan storan data termasuk penyulitan simetri, penyulitan asimetri dan algoritma cincang. Kaedah ini boleh digunakan secara individu atau gabungan untuk meningkatkan keselamatan data.
Atas ialah kandungan terperinci Kaedah penyulitan storan data. Untuk maklumat lanjut, sila ikut artikel berkaitan lain di laman web China PHP!